True, first-person account by the controversial publisher who was jailed in 1972 on obscenity charges following a decision by the US Supreme Court against his quarterly magazine, Eros, which featured erotic literary works on love & sex. Speaks chillingly to challenges today--more than 50 years later--to our right to free speech & our freedom to read. Both heartbreaking & heartwarming, this is a fictionalized account of the true story of Dita Kraus, a 14-year-old Czech girl imprisoned at Auschwitz until rescued by the Allies at the end of WWII, who not only survived, but maintained a secret library of 8 books that she distributed to her fellow prisoners & kept their spirits alive. In 423 pages, with profiles of some of the reali-life characters & what happened to them, along with bibliographic sources, in rear. Orig. published in Spanish in 2012, & translated into English in 2017, this is the FIRST AMERICAN EDITION from that same year, but a later (11th) printing.
